在Visual Studio

时间:2017-12-27 21:02:45

标签: c# visual-studio

我想重命名项目/解决方案名称,例如从Project1.sln重命名为Project2.sln

只是简单地转到View>然后,属性窗口重命名Name属性,还是有一个额外的步骤?

3 个答案:

答案 0 :(得分:1)

在视觉工作室中重命名项目可能具有挑战性,因为香草视觉工作室对你没什么帮助。 (阅读=手动编辑文件)

  

如果您还想重命名文件系统文件夹,则必须执行许多手动步骤:

     
      
  • 在Visual Studio外部重命名项目文件夹。
  •   
  • 更改解决方案文件(.sln)中的项目名称
  •   
  • 更改引用(使用)的其他项目中的项目名称
  •   
  • 重命名项目文件名
  •   
  • 更改程序集名称和信息
  •   
  • 更改默认/根名称空间
  •   

有一个visual studio插件可以轻松重命名项目:

https://marketplace.visualstudio.com/items?itemName=KuanyshNabiyev.FullRenameProject

答案 1 :(得分:0)

如果像我们大多数人一样,您的命名空间基于项目名称,那么您需要重命名所有命名空间以匹配。您还需要在属性中更改项目的默认命名空间。

答案 2 :(得分:0)

或者您使用我为自己编写的工具,该工具还处理git重命名,这样就不会丢失历史记录,移至其他目录等。

通过dotnet tool install -g ModernRonin.ProjectRenamer安装,请参见https://github.com/ModernRonin/ProjectRenamer以获得文档。